XML 73 R50.htm IDEA: XBRL DOCUMENT v3.8.0.1
Development and License Agreements - Additional Information (Detail) - USD ($)
3 Months Ended
Mar. 31, 2018
Mar. 31, 2017
Dec. 31, 2017
Licenses Agreements [Line Items]      
Payments made relating to the manufacturing of the products $ 5,400,000 $ 3,200,000  
BARDA Agreement      
Licenses Agreements [Line Items]      
Committed fund receivable 88,200,000    
Committed fund receivable $ 186,200,000    
Period of agreement 5 years    
Accounts receivable of billed and unbilled amounts $ 2,000,000   $ 1,400,000
BARDA Agreement | Cerus Corporation      
Licenses Agreements [Line Items]      
Co-investment by the company 5,000,000    
Additional co-investment by the company $ 9,600,000